Workshop Descriptions
(Rev. 06/26/2008)
|
|
Jump
Start Your Job Search (90 minutes)
"An Orientation to Lake1Stop
Services"
Attend this session to learn about the new workshops and job
search assistance available to you through Lake1Stop.
Receive a Job Search Planning Tool to guide you through an
effective job search to that next new job.
NOTE:
this session is a pre-requisite for attending the
workshops or meeting with a Job Placement Specialist. |
|
Applications & Job Search Letters (3hours)
Learn to
avoid some common mistakes when completing employment
applications and give a great first impression to an
employer; how to write an attention-getting cover letter to
send with a resume, marketing letters that will open doors
to unadvertised opportunities, and follow-up letters that
set you apart from other job applicants. |
Resume Development (3 hours)
Covers
resume content, selection of best resume format,
highlighting accomplishments, tips on deciding what to
include and what to leave out. Make the employer want to
talk to you by writing a strong, focused resume! |
|
Interviewing Techniques (6 hours)
Learn to
“sell yourself” to an employer! This workshop covers the
secrets of preparing for interviews, handling difficult
questions, knowing what questions to ask, evaluating a job
offer and negotiating salary and benefits. |
Uncovering the Hidden Job
Market
(3 hours)
Learn how to maximize the effectiveness of your job
search by using a combination of research and networking to
find jobs that are not advertised and to meet the people who
can help you get them. |
|
Take This Job & Keep It!
(2 hours)
Keeping
a job is often all about accepting the right job in the
first place. Learn what you need to know to make the right
decision, and then how to handle the first weeks on the job
to make a successful adjustment. |
Introduction to the Internet (3 hours)
Learn to
use Internet search tools effectively, create an e-mail
account, attach documents, conduct Labor Market research,
register and post your résumé on job search web sites. |
|
Introduction to Computers (9 hours)
Introduces computer hardware and software and basics of
working in MS Windows and Word; designed for individuals
with limited experience on computers; teaches the skills
needed to prepare a resume and cover letter using MS Word. |
